Description

The CNC Maintenance Technician’s primary responsibility is troubleshooting CNC equipment and ensuring Planned Maintenance (PM) procedures are completed.  The technician will also support the documentation of PM procedures. Additionally, the qualified incumbent will:
 

  • Repair CNC Machinery, Manual Machine and Machining Centers
  • Install, troubleshoot, repair and maintain machine tool equipment and controls
  • Troubleshoot hydraulics, electronics, and software, electrical, pneumatic and mechanical systems
  • Use machine tool manuals, technical documents, and internal and vendor resources to research machine issues
  • Identify and replace parts as necessary
  • Complete testing and adjust of parts as needed
  • Complete planned and preventative procedures
  • Perform PM
  • Repair and maintain manual machines
  • Coordinate with external suppliers and maintenance companies to ensure timely and accurate completion of work
  • Work based on a sense of urgency with machine down conditions
  • In conjunction with production, develop PM schedule
  • General facilities maintenance


Minimum Requirements and Qualifications

 
  • Ability to read part manuals, electrical and mechanical schematics, assembly instructions and troubleshooting guides.
  • Experience with FANUC, Siemens and OEM controls.
  • Demonstrated high degree of industrial mechanical, pneumatic, hydraulic and electrical aptitude and repair abilities.
  • Advanced knowledge of CNC machine design and operation.
  • Advanced knowledge of and experience with electrical test equipment, electrical, hydraulic and mechanical systems


Physical Requirements

Ability to lift 35 lbs., stand, walk, bend/stoop on a regular basis.
 

Education and Abilities Requirements

High School Diploma. Skilled Trade Certification, preferred. Ability to comprehend given instructions. Ability to multitask job duties effectively and efficiently. Ability to work unsupervised. Ability to work flex schedules and weekends as required. Reading, writing and general math skills. Ability to work effectively in a group (Team) environment. Effective written and verbal communication skills. Attention to detail.
